What companies run services between Bruges, Belgium and Paris, France?

You can take a train from Bruges to Paris Nord via Brussel-Zuid / Bruxelles-Midi in around 2h 30m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Bruges to Paris 5 times a week. Tickets cost €24–45 and the journey takes 4h 20m.
